Biden nominee for CDC director shows great interest in university COVID-19 preparedness, sets “very high bar” for reopening in-person instruction

On December 7, 2020, President-elect Joe Biden announced Dr. Rochelle Walensky as his nominee for director of the Center for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C), the federal organization primarily responsible for controlling the introduction and spread of infectious diseases including COVID-19....
